Sleeping with a Killer -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

Michelle Boat
The story of Michelle Boat, who killed her estranged husband's girlfriend in a jealous rage.

Dana Mackay
The 2013 murder of Dana Mackay, who was attacked by her husband's mistress and two accomplices while she was recovering from surgery in hospital.

Ashley Mead
A jealous man takes matters into his own hands when his ex-girlfriend moves on from their relationship, killing her and dismembering her body.

Melanie Eam
When James Barry breaks up with his girlfriend Melanie Eam in 2016, she retaliates by snatching his life away.

Brenda Delgado
A woman orchestrates a gruesome murder-for-hire plot when she becomes jealous of another woman's relationship with her ex.

Raul Ortiz
A violent confrontation over an alleged inappropriate comment leads to one man's death in Tampa, Florida.

Alice Ruggles
The story of 24-year-old Alice Ruggles, who was murdered by her ex-boyfriend after a terrifying campaign of stalking and harassment following the end of their brief relationship.

Tawnee Baird
Twenty-one-year-old Tawnee Baird died at the hands of her girlfriend, Victoria Mendoza, who stabbed her in a jealousy-fuelled frenzy while she was driving.

Skylar Neese
On July 6, 2012, surveillance footage captured 16-year-old Skylar Neese sneaking out of her bedroom window and getting into a car at 12.30am; that was the last time she was seen alive.

Jay Sewell
The story of 18-year-old Jay Sewell, whose life was taken in a brutal attack orchestrated by the jealous Daniel Grogan, who had heard that Jay was seeing his ex-girlfriend.

Pedro Bravo
The story of the kidnapping and murder of university freshman Christian Aguilar, by Pedro Bravo, who was consumed with jealousy when Christian began dating his ex.

Seath Jackson
The chilling story of 15-year-old Seath Jackson, lured to a brutal death by his ex-girlfriend Amber Wright, who then helped to conceal the murder.

Donna Horwitz
After being enraged at the thought of her husband spending a weekend away with her nemesis, a woman takes matters into her own hands and brutally ends a life.
